Washington was a male of technology, that hardly ever allowed an opportunity slip byand when he hired a Scottish ranch manager in 1797, Washington added an additional line to his return to: bourbon seller. The planation supervisor, James Anderson, had immigrated to Virginia in the very early 1790snoticed a missed opportunity at the estate: the abundance of plants, incorporated with Washington's advanced gristmill and bountiful water supply could be utilized to make scotch.


Some Known Details About Hush And Whisper Distilling Co.


Washington, to aid promote healthy and balanced dirt, grew a whole lot of rye as a cover plant. Rye wasn't high on the listing of delicious, edible grains, however Anderson really did not think it should go to wasteinstead, he intended to turn it into whiskey. Texas Whiskey. Washington was, initially, hesitant to leap into a new company ventureafter all, at 65 years of ages, he had wished to invest his retired years in family member tranquility, but after hearing Anderson's proposition, along with referring a pal who was associated with read this post here the rum service, Washington acquiesced




When Washington passed away in 1799, he left the distillery to his nephew Lawrence Lewis, who lacked the wise business mind of Washington. Lewis wasn't almost as successful in the distilling company, and when a fire melted the distillery to the ground in 1814, it had not been restored. The state of Virginia purchased the site in the early 1930s, and planned to rebuild the distillery, yet just took care of to restore the gristmill and miller's cottagemostly because the stress of Prohibition and the Anxiety didn't motivate the restoring of the distillery.


By 2007, the distillery was open to the general public. However the rejuvinated distillery is more than a fixed homage to Washington's business-savvy: it's a fully-functioning distillery in its very own right. Each year, Steve Bashore, manager of historic professions at Mount Vernon, leads a tiny team in distilling whiskey precisely as Anderson and others did in the original distillery.

Like Washington's initial dish, the scotch they are making is predominately rye, with 65 percent of the mash composed of rye grain, 35 percent corn, and 5 percent malted barley. https://hushnwh1sper.bandcamp.com/album/hush-and-whisper-distilling-co. The grains are ground in the gristmill, then contributed to barrels in the distillery in addition to 110 gallons of boiling water




On the third day of the process, yeast is added, which consumes the sugars and turns them into alcohol. Then, the mash is poured right into the copper stills (which we recreated from a surviving 18th-century still shown in the distillery's gallery, on the building's 2nd flooring), where it is warmed by a timber fire.


As the alcohol vapor cools, it condenses back to liquid, which spurts of the barrel right into a container. To see exactly how whiskey is made at Mount Vernon, take a look at the video below. In Washington's day, this whiskey would certainly be offered clear and unagedbut today (due to the fact that there's a market for it), Bashore and Mount Vernon will mature a few of the whiskey that they boil down.
